NotchPad lives inside your MacBook Pro notch. Click it and start typing. No window switching, no alt+tab, no losing focus. It's a notepad, clipboard manager, and snippets tool that's always one click away. AES-256 encryption with 1Password, Bitwarden and Touch ID support. Everything stays local on your Mac. Free 15-day trial, then $9.99 one-time purchase, no subscription.

Hey everyone 👋 I'm Oncel, I designed and built NotchPad over a weekend. Two things bugged me for a long time. Every notes app on Mac needs its own window and an alt+tab to get to and the MacBook Pro notch just sits there doing nothing. So I put a notes app inside it. It also does clipboard history and code snippets with syntax highlighting. Everything is encrypted and stays on your machine, nothing touches a server.
